(−)-Blebbistatin
(−)-Blebbistatin (CAS: 856925-71-8, C18H16N2O2) is a selective inhibitor of non-muscle myosin II, essential for cellular processes like cytokinesis and muscle contraction. This small molecule bioactive compound is crucial for research into cell motility, apoptosis, and cell cycle regulation. Its ability to disrupt the actin cytoskeleton makes it an invaluable tool in cell biology laboratories investigating fundamental cellular mechanics and signalling pathways. Myosin II Inhibition
(−)-Blebbistatin acts as a potent and specific inhibitor of myosin II ATPase activity. This allows researchers to study the role of myosin II in various cellular functions, including cell division, migration, and contractility.
Cytoskeletal Research
By disrupting the interaction between actin and myosin, blebbistatin provides a valuable tool for investigating the dynamics of the actin cytoskeleton. It is used to probe cellular structural organization and mechanical properties.
Apoptosis and Cell Cycle Studies
Research suggests that myosin II activity is implicated in apoptosis and cell cycle progression. (–)-Blebbistatin can be employed to explore these connections and understand the molecular mechanisms involved.
Cell Motility and Migration
As myosin II is critical for cell shape and movement, blebbistatin is frequently used to study cell migration dynamics, wound healing models, and other processes dependent on cellular motility.
| Molecular weight | 292.33 |
|---|---|
| Empirical formula | C18H16N2O2 |
| Form | solid |
| Solubility | DMSO: soluble5 mg/mLchloroform: soluble(lit.)ethyl acetate: soluble(lit.)methanol: soluble(lit.)methylene chloride: soluble(lit.) |
| Storage temperature | −20°C |
